Bạn là lập trình viên mới vào nghề hay đang tìm hiểu về quản lý mã nguồn? Github là nền tảng không thể thiếu cho công việc của bạn. Vậy Github là gì và làm thế nào để bắt đầu sử dụng? Bài viết này trên gamemoihot.com sẽ hướng dẫn bạn chi tiết cách tạo tài khoản và cài đặt Github trên máy tính một cách đơn giản và nhanh chóng.
Github: Kho Mã Nguồn Tuyệt Vời Cho Mọi Lập Trình Viên
Github là dịch vụ lưu trữ mã nguồn Git phổ biến nhất hiện nay, được ví như “mạng xã hội” dành riêng cho lập trình viên. Nó không chỉ cung cấp đầy đủ tính năng của Git, hệ thống quản lý phiên bản code, mà còn cho phép người dùng tương tác, chia sẻ và cộng tác trong các dự án phần mềm. Github nổi bật với khả năng lưu trữ, bảo mật cao và kho dữ liệu mở đồ sộ.
Nói một cách đơn giản, Github là sự kết hợp giữa:
- Git: Hệ thống quản lý dự án và phiên bản code.
- Hub: Nơi kết nối các lập trình viên, giúp họ chia sẻ và cộng tác trong các dự án.
Việc sử dụng Github mang lại nhiều lợi ích cho lập trình viên, đặc biệt là trong các dự án nhóm, giúp dễ dàng theo dõi thay đổi, khôi phục code và quản lý phiên bản hiệu quả. Sau khi được Microsoft mua lại vào năm 2018, Github càng được đầu tư và phát triển mạnh mẽ hơn.
Github – Mạng xã hội cho lập trình viên
Tính Năng Nổi Bật Của Github
Github sở hữu nhiều tính năng hữu ích, giúp công việc của lập trình viên trở nên dễ dàng và hiệu quả hơn:
- Gist: Lưu trữ và chia sẻ nhanh chóng các đoạn code bằng cách kéo thả.
- WebFlow: Quản lý kho lưu trữ (repo) trực tiếp trên giao diện web.
- Git URL Shortener: Rút gọn URL repo để chia sẻ dễ dàng trên mạng xã hội.
- Tìm kiếm tập tin: Nhanh chóng định vị tập tin cần thiết bằng phím tắt
T
. - Github Emoji: Sử dụng biểu tượng cảm xúc để thể hiện cảm xúc khi review code.
- Linking Lines: Chia sẻ đường link trỏ đến dòng code cụ thể.
- Hiển thị đa dạng định dạng: Tự động hiển thị file CSV dưới dạng bảng, geoJSON thành bản đồ và STL thành mô hình 3D.
- Task Checklist: Tạo danh sách công việc cần làm trong pull request.
Những tính năng hữu ích của GithubGithub Desktop – Công cụ mạnh mẽ cho lập trình viên
Hướng Dẫn Tạo Tài Khoản Github
Tạo Tài Khoản Nhanh
Truy cập github.com, điền thông tin đăng ký và nhấn “Sign up for Github”. Sau đó, kiểm tra email và kích hoạt tài khoản.
Tạo Tài Khoản Chi Tiết
- Truy cập trang web github.com.
- Điền đầy đủ thông tin theo yêu cầu (tên đăng nhập, email, mật khẩu) và nhấn “Sign up for Github”.
Đăng ký tài khoản Github - Kiểm tra email và click vào đường link kích hoạt để hoàn tất đăng ký.
Kích hoạt tài khoản Github qua email
Hướng Dẫn Tải và Cài Đặt Github Desktop
Cài Đặt Nhanh
Vào desktop.github.com, tải phiên bản phù hợp với hệ điều hành, chạy file cài đặt và làm theo hướng dẫn. Đăng nhập bằng tài khoản Github vừa tạo.
Cài Đặt Chi Tiết
- Truy cập desktop.github.com và tải phiên bản Github Desktop cho Windows.
- Chạy file cài đặt vừa tải về. Github Desktop sẽ tự động cài đặt.
Cài đặt Github Desktop - Sau khi cài đặt hoàn tất, chọn “Sign in to GitHub.com”.
Đăng nhập Github Desktop - Nhập tên đăng nhập và mật khẩu, sau đó nhấn “Sign in”.
Đăng nhập với tài khoản Github - Điền tên và email hiển thị trên Github, nhấn “Continue”.
Cấu hình thông tin hiển thị - Nhấn “Finish” để hoàn tất cài đặt.
Hoàn tất cài đặt
Giờ đây bạn đã sẵn sàng khám phá thế giới Github!
Giao diện Github DesktopGiao diện Github Desktop
Kết Luận
Hy vọng bài viết này đã giúp bạn hiểu rõ hơn về Github và cách tạo tài khoản, cài đặt Github Desktop trên máy tính. Hãy bắt đầu khám phá và trải nghiệm những tính năng tuyệt vời mà Github mang lại cho công việc lập trình của bạn. Đừng quên để lại bình luận bên dưới nếu bạn có bất kỳ thắc mắc nào!